Islanders' Schaefer: Calder Winner at 18!

Matthew Schaefer, a defenseman drafted by the New York Islanders, has achieved a significant milestone by becoming the youngest recipient of the Calder Trophy. This prestigious award recognizes him as the league's top rookie, an honor he earned at 18 years and 223 days old. He outperformed many seasoned players during his debut season.

Schaefer's rookie campaign saw him record 59 points in 82 games, including 23 goals. He maintained a positive plus-minus rating and averaged nearly 25 minutes of ice time per game, demonstrating remarkable poise and skill for his age. His ability to influence the game's tempo was a standout aspect of his play.

Looking ahead, Schaefer is widely expected to become a future captain for the Islanders and develop into a premier defenseman for many years. His immediate embrace by the Islanders' community suggests a strong, lasting connection with the team and its fanbase.
